Conference Title: 2013 5th International Conference on Power Electronics Systems and Applications (PESA) New Energy Conversion for the 21st Century Conference Start Date: 2013, Dec. 11 Conference End Date: 2013, Dec. 13 Conference Location: Hong Kong In this paper, a passivity-based control (PBC) algorithm with disturbance reject is proposed to obtain precise position control of a Linear Switched Reluctance Motor (LSRM) driving system in short distance applications. In the framework of the two-time-scale analysis, the whole system is decomposed into two reduced-order models. With the models, an improved PBC algorithm is designed to reject the nonlinear friction in the outer loop. Three simulations are performed and the results demonstrate the improved control algorithm is effective for the LSRM position tracking system in short distance applications. [PUBLICATION ABSTRACT]
